PUBLIC CHARGE
The Board of Commissioners pledges to the residents of Orange County its respect. The Board asks its
residents to conduct themselves in a respectful, courteous manner, both with the Board and with fellow
residents. At any time should any member of the Board or any resident fail to observe this public charge,
the Chair will ask the offending person to leave the meeting until that individual regains personal control.
Should decorum fail to be restored, the Chair will recess the meeting until such time that a genuine
commitment to this public charge is observed. All electronic devices such as cell phones, pagers, and
computers should please be turned off or set to silent/vibrate.

Petitions/Resolutions/Proclamations and other similar requests submitted by the public will not be acted
upon by the Board of Commissioners at the time presented. All such requests will be referred for
Chair/Vice Chair/Manager review and for recommendations to the full Board at a later date regarding a)
consideration of the request at a future regular Board meeting; or b) receipt of the request as information
only. Submittal of information to the Board or receipt of information by the Board does not constitute
approval, endorsement, or consent.
